Abstract :
A brief review on application and development of neural networks to time series forecasting is presented, in which the main point is placed on Bayesian neural networks and Bayesian evolutionary neural trees (BENTs). Furthermore, the BENTs techniques are applied to a time series forecast of the daily balance of accounts of the customers in a branch of a bank
